Output 28843915f364f3a868f1599bd22786624848f8ff9532ac0bb39435d9b8dc7f99:0

value
25943190
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5cd6b32140ba245a7ea9eb3e86296a1d4d7829b0 OP_EQUAL
address
MGN3bgDxa1S3EgmtfU4H3A1f36VjKCn1Gk
transaction
28843915f364f3a868f1599bd22786624848f8ff9532ac0bb39435d9b8dc7f99
spent
true